Gov. Gavin Newsom (D-CA) lashed out at Republicans for their negative reactions to the start of Pride Month. “It’s amazing watching MAGA melt down over Pride Month. We’re genuinely sorry your life is this miserable. Try loving gay people. The vibes are better, the music is better, and everyone seems to be having fun,” Newsom’s press office posted on X.
